School-related gender-based violence (SRGBV) can be defined as ‘acts or threats of sexual, physical, or psychological violence occurring in and around school, perpetrated as a result of gender norms and stereotypes, and enforced by unequal power dynamics’. Gender-based violence (GBV) refers to any act done to someone against their will as a result of gender-norms, and unequal power relationships. Every year World Vision joins worldwide communities to speak out against gender-based violence (GBV) during the 16 Days Campaign.The campaign starts on November 25 (the International Day for the Elimination of Violence against Women) and ends on December 10 (Human Rights Day) to highlight the connection between GBV and the violation of human rights.
